Show MISS TAYLOR The Tribune of this morning makes an extract from the Springfield Republican about Miss Helen Taylor the stepdaughter stepdaugh-ter of John Stuart Mill and sajs she has accepted a nomination to Parliament Miss Taylor is known to most of the world as a reformer and womans rights I woman Reared as j she was among the most advanced thinkers of England and the age the disciples of the elder Mill and Bentham and the able and brilliant men who were of the school of the Westminster she coud not be other than what she is in her public life Her mother if we may credit what Mill says of her in his autobiography was one of the most remarkable women of any age and his devotion to her was as jrreat as the devotion of Dante to the ideal Beatrice or of Petrarch to Laura It was of Helen Taylors mother that Mill says Her memory is to me a religion and her approbation the standard by which summing up as it does all excellence 1 endeavor to regulate my life It is a noble tribute to any woman and one that is rarely paid by so great a man It seems strange that Mill who was so true anil devoted to his wife Miss Tailors mother should rest forever in the same city where Petrarch first saw Laura and knew love But in the old papal city he sleeps and almost within the shadow of its palace walls The infidel and unbeliever finds peace within the precincts where the Church was wont to be supreme and where heresy never found a place And to Avignon each year comes Helen Taylor and over the grave of the apostle of liberty strews flowers and sees that the hedge around the grave where he sleeps is kept as pure and beautiful as was the soul that of her and her welfare was so careful care-ful and tender t The old French lady who keeps and watches over that grave and shows it to the wonderer and worshipper tells as she shows it the story of Helen Taylors annual pilgrimage pil-grimage to the grave of John Stuart Mill and says M Mill was the great Englishman Eng-lishman whom all the world knew and and he loved Arignon and here he chose to sleep forever And Mlle Taylor ah she is a good and beautiful woman I nr |
